輸配電市場成長因素

全球輸配電市場預計將迎來顯著成長,主要驅動因素包括電氣化需求的成長、再生能源併網以及老舊電網基礎設施的現代化改造。2025年市場規模達到3,979.9億美元,預計2026年將達到4,108億美元,到2034年將進一步成長至5,805.1億美元,預測期內年複合成長率(CAGR)為4.42%。亞太地區將在2025年佔據42.78%的市場佔有率,主要驅動因素是快速的工業化、都市化以及大規模再生能源併網。

市場動態

驅動因素:

1. 轉型為再生能源:風能和太陽能等再生能源併入電網的進程在全球加速。根據IRENA的 "Renewables 2023" ,2023年全球再生能源裝置容量將達到 507 GW,比2022年成長約 50%。這種快速成長需要引進高壓輸電線路升級和柔性交流輸電系統(FACTS)等技術,以應對發電量的波動,確保電網的穩定性和效率。

2. 各行業電氣化進程加快:電動車(EV)的快速普及以及工業流程和供暖的電氣化推動電力需求的成長。2023年全球電動車銷量達到1,400萬輛,佔汽車總銷量的18%,較2022年成長35%。不斷成長的需求推動了對可靠輸配電基礎設施的需求,以支持不斷擴大的電力負載。

限制因素:

  • 基礎設施成本高:更換老化的輸電線路、變壓器和變電站需要大量投資。在美國,超過45-50%的輸電線路和變壓器已使用超過25年。美國能源部估計,到2030年,需要超過2兆美元用於升級電網以維持其可靠性。在財政資源和技術專長有限的發展中地區,也存在類似的挑戰。
  • 監管複雜:冗長的審批流程和複雜的合規要求會延誤專案實施,並進一步阻礙市場成長。

機會:

  • 智慧電網技術:各國政府和電力公司加大對電網自動化、儲能、高級計量基礎設施(AMI)和數位化方面的投資,以最佳化電力流動、提高效率並整合再生能源。歐盟委員會已宣布計劃在2030年之前向電網投資 6,330億美元,其中 1,840億美元將用於電網數位化。日本和印度也分別啟動了投資 1,550億美元和 380億美元用於智慧電網系統的計畫。

挑戰:

  • 技術複雜性:整合再生能源和分散式能源(DER)需要對電網進行改造和採用先進的工程技術。雙向電力流動、數位化電網管理和網路安全的考量增加了營運的複雜性和成本,給公用事業公司和輸配電服務供應商帶來了挑戰。

市場趨勢

  • 新興地區投資增加:非洲、拉丁美洲和亞洲的電氣化率上升。世界銀行和非洲開發銀行的目標是到2030年為非洲超過3億人口提供電力。
  • 微電網和分散式系統:日本和澳洲等國家投資社區微電網,以提高電網韌性、能源安全並整合再生能源。

新冠疫情的影響

新冠疫情擾亂了輸配電(T&D)產業,導致勞動力短缺,並延誤了維護和建設專案。2020年,居民用電量增加了6%,而商業和工業用電需求下降了10%,迫使電力公司迅速做出反應以維持電網穩定。

Growth Factors of electricity transmission and distribution (T&D) Market

The global electricity transmission and distribution (T&D) market is poised for significant growth, driven by the increasing demand for electrification, integration of renewable energy, and the modernization of aging grid infrastructure. The market was valued at USD 397.99 billion in 2025, projected to reach USD 410.8 billion in 2026, and is expected to grow to USD 580.51 billion by 2034, reflecting a CAGR of 4.42% during the forecast period. Asia Pacific dominated the market in 2025 with a 42.78% share, primarily due to rapid industrialization, urbanization, and large-scale renewable energy integration.

Market Dynamics

Drivers:

1. Transition to Renewable Energy: The integration of renewable sources such as wind and solar into electricity grids is accelerating globally. According to IRENA's Renewables 2023 report, global renewable energy capacity reached 507 GW in 2023, almost 50% higher than in 2022. This surge necessitates upgrades to high-voltage transmission lines and technologies like Flexible AC Transmission Systems (FACTS) to handle variable energy generation, ensuring grid stability and efficiency.

2. Increasing Electrification Across Sectors: Rapid adoption of Electric Vehicles (EVs) and electrification of industrial and heating processes is fueling electricity demand. In 2023, global EV sales reached 14 million, accounting for 18% of total car sales-a 35% increase from 2022. This rising demand drives the need for reliable T&D infrastructure capable of supporting expanding electricity loads.

Restraints:

  • High Infrastructure Costs: Upgrading aging transmission lines, transformers, and substations involves significant investment. In the U.S., over 45-50% of transmission lines and transformers are more than 25 years old. The U.S. Department of Energy estimates that more than USD 2 trillion is required by 2030 for T&D upgrades to maintain reliability. Similar challenges exist in developing regions due to limited funding and technical expertise.
  • Regulatory Complexities: Lengthy permitting processes and complex compliance requirements can delay project implementation, further hampering market growth.

Opportunities:

  • Smart Grid Technologies: Governments and utilities are increasingly investing in grid automation, energy storage, advanced metering infrastructure (AMI), and digitalization to optimize electricity flow, improve efficiency, and integrate renewable sources. The European Commission announced a USD 633 billion investment in electricity grids by 2030, with USD 184 billion dedicated to grid digitalization. Japan and India have similarly launched programs investing USD 155 billion and USD 38 billion, respectively, in smart grid systems.

Challenges:

  • Technical Complexity: Integrating renewable energy and distributed energy resources (DERs) requires grid modifications and advanced engineering. Bi-directional power flows, digital grid management, and cybersecurity considerations increase operational complexity and costs, creating challenges for utilities and T&D service providers.

Market Trends

  • Growing Investments in Emerging Regions: Africa, Latin America, and Asia are experiencing increasing electrification rates. The World Bank and African Development Bank aim to provide electricity access to over 300 million people in Africa by 2030.
  • Microgrids and Decentralized Systems: Countries like Japan and Australia are investing in localized microgrids to improve resilience, energy security, and integration of renewable energy sources.

Impact of COVID-19

The COVID-19 pandemic disrupted the T&D sector by causing workforce shortages and delaying maintenance and construction projects. Residential electricity consumption rose by 6% in 2020, while commercial and industrial demand fell by 10%, leading utilities to adapt rapidly to maintain grid stability.

Competitive Landscape

Key players include Power Grid Corporation of China, Kiewit Corporation, Fluor Corporation, Larsen & Toubro, Duke Energy, Enel SpA, National Grid plc, and State Grid Corporation of China. Competition focuses on project execution, technological expertise, regulatory compliance, and customized solutions. Notable developments include:

  • Power Grid Corporation of India (2024): Acquired RIVEPTL to strengthen national grid infrastructure.
  • Dominion Energy (2024): Commissioned a 36.5-mile 500 kV transmission line to meet regional power demands.
  • Tata Power & Enel (2023): Collaborated to automate and digitalize Delhi's distribution system.

Investment Analysis

Major utilities and governments are investing heavily in grid modernization, smart meters, renewable integration, and digital grid management. Enel Group plans a USD 38.96 billion investment by 2026, distributed across Italy, Iberia, Latin America, and North America. The U.S. DOE allocated USD 3.46 billion in 2023 for 58 T&D projects nationwide.
